Civil Engineering and Construction Engineering Management (CECEM)

Long Beach students receive theoretical and practical experience in planning, analyzing, designing and constructing all types of private and public works projects. Graduates emerge fully prepared to engage in projects for engineering consulting firms, industry, construction and development companies and government agencies.

Construction Engineering Management

The Construction Engineering Management (BSCEM) degree program applies scientific and management principles to oversee and coordinate design, administrative and construction personnel. Graduates are frequently employed in the service industry such as construction loan engineer or material purchasing agent; in the construction industry such as contractor, project engineer or administrator, estimator or scheduler; or in the manufacturing industry as a facilities, safety or planning engineer.
